Best approach to integrating the CST technology in a conventional cement plant is to use solar tower systemwith solar reactor at the top of the solar tower or preheater tower. Ancillary services, leveraged through advanced wind turbine controls, can support grid stability, reliability, and resilience. Smart Grids are advanced electricity networks that use digital technology to monitor and manage the flow of electricity.
